Sclerocarya Birrea
''Sclerocarya birrea'' ( grc, σκληρός , "hard", and , "nut", in reference to the stone inside the fleshy fruit), commonly known as the marula, is a medium-sized deciduous fruit-bearing tree, indigenous to the miombo woodlands of Southern Africa, the Sudano-Sahelian range of West Africa, the savanna woodlands of East Africa and Madagascar. Description The tree is a single stemmed tree with a wide spreading crown. It is characterised by a grey mottled bark. The tree grows up to 18 m tall mostly in low altitudes and open woodlands. The distribution of this species throughout Africa and Madagascar has followed the Bantu in their migrations. There is some evidence of human domestication of marula trees, as trees found on farm lands tend to have larger fruit size. The fruits, which ripen between December and March, have a light yellow skin (exocarp), with white flesh (mesocarp). Anacardiaceae
The Anacardiaceae, commonly known as the cashew family or sumac family, are a family of flowering plants, including about 83 genera with about 860 known species. Members of the Anacardiaceae bear fruits that are drupes and in some cases produce urushiol, an irritant. The Anacardiaceae include numerous genera, several of which are economically important, notably cashew (in the type genus ''Anacardium''), mango, Chinese lacquer tree, yellow mombin, Peruvian pepper, poison ivy, poison oak, sumac, smoke tree, marula and cuachalalate. The genus ''Pistacia'' (which includes the pistachio and mastic tree) is now included, but was previously placed in its own family, the Pistaciaceae. Description Trees or shrubs, each has inconspicuous flowers and resinous or milky sap that may be highly poisonous, as in black poisonwood and sometimes foul-smelling. Christian Ferdinand Friedrich Hochstetter
Christian Ferdinand Friedrich Hochstetter (16 February 1787 – 20 February 1860) was a German botanist and Protestant minister. Biography Hochstetter was born in Stuttgart in Baden-Württemberg. He was the father of geologist Ferdinand Hochstetter (1829–1884). In 1807 Hochstetter received his degree of Master of Divinity in Tübingen. While still a student, he became a member of a secret organization headed by Carl Ludwig Reichenbach (1788–1869) that had designs on establishing a colony on Tahiti (''Otaheiti-Gesellschaft''). In 1808 the organization was discovered by authorities, and its members suspected of treason and arrested. Hochstetter was imprisoned for a short period of time for his small role in the secret society. Later on, he spent six months as a teacher in a private institution in Erlangen, and afterwards was a tutor for four years in the house of the Minister of Altenstein in Thuringia. Plant
Plants are predominantly photosynthetic eukaryotes of the kingdom Plantae. Historically, the plant kingdom encompassed all living things that were not animals, and included algae and fungi; however, all current definitions of Plantae exclude the fungi and some algae, as well as the prokaryotes (the archaea and bacteria). By one definition, plants form the clade Viridiplantae (Latin name for "green plants") which is sister of the Glaucophyta, and consists of the green algae and Embryophyta (land plants). The latter includes the flowering plants, conifers and other gymnosperms, ferns and their allies, hornworts, liverworts, and mosses. Most plants are multicellular organisms. Green plants obtain most of their energy from sunlight via photosynthesis by primary chloroplasts that are derived from endosymbiosis with cyanobacteria.
